WebJan 26, 2024 · Insolation or Incoming Solar Radiation. As we all know, the sun is the primary source of energy for the earth. The sun radiates its energy in all directions into space in short wavelengths, which is known as solar radiation.; The earth’s surface receives only a part of this radiated energy (2 units out of 1,00,00,00,000 units of energy radiated by the sun). WebMeasurement Systems Analysis (MSA) Measurement Systems Analysis (MSA) is a tool for analyzing the variation present in each type of inspection, measurement, and test equipment. It is the system used to assess the quality of the measurement system. In other words, it allows us to ensure that the variation in our measurement is minimal compared ... flo heater mor water

WebNov 2, 2024 · Contents show. Turning is a machining process performed on a machine in which the cutting tool (non-rotary tool bit) follows a helix tool path by moving linearly along the workpiece. Turning traditionally refers to the action of cutting external surfaces, whereas “ boring ” refers to the action of cutting internal surfaces (holes). flöhe bekämpfen apothekeWeb1.
